Question 1

A study finds that third-grade students who struggle with spelling irregular words often show parallel difficulties with reading fluency, even when their phonics knowledge is adequate. However, these same students typically show age-appropriate listening comprehension. Which explanation best accounts for this specific pattern of strengths and difficulties?

  1. Irregular word spelling and fluent reading both require well-developed orthographic memory for whole word patterns (correct answer)
  2. Phonics knowledge deficits simultaneously impair both spelling accuracy and reading rate development
  3. Listening comprehension skills develop independently and do not rely on orthographic processing abilities
  4. Vocabulary limitations prevent students from recognizing familiar words during both spelling and reading tasks
Explanation: Both spelling irregular words and fluent reading require orthographic memory - the ability to store and rapidly retrieve whole word visual patterns. Irregular words cannot be spelled through phonics alone, and fluent reading requires instant recognition of word patterns. Adequate listening comprehension confirms that language skills are intact, pointing to orthographic processing as the specific weakness affecting both spelling and fluency.

Question 2

A literacy assessment reveals that students with limited background knowledge in science topics show poor comprehension of science texts despite demonstrating strong decoding skills and adequate general vocabulary. However, these same students comprehend narrative texts at grade level. This pattern most clearly demonstrates which principle about literacy component interactions?

  1. Decoding skills transfer automatically across all text types regardless of content knowledge differences
  2. General vocabulary knowledge is sufficient for comprehension across all academic subject areas
  3. Domain-specific background knowledge plays a critical role in comprehension beyond general language skills (correct answer)
  4. Narrative text comprehension relies on different cognitive processes than informational text comprehension
Explanation: This pattern shows that domain-specific background knowledge is crucial for comprehension beyond general literacy skills. Students can decode and have general vocabulary, but lack the specific conceptual knowledge needed to understand science content. Their success with narratives confirms their general literacy abilities, highlighting how specialized background knowledge becomes increasingly important for academic text comprehension.

Question 3

A second-grade teacher observes that several students can accurately decode multisyllabic words when reading aloud but demonstrate poor comprehension of the same text. These students also show strong performance on phonemic segmentation tasks and spelling assessments. Based on the relationships among literacy components, which factor is most likely limiting these students' reading comprehension?

  1. Insufficient phonological awareness skills that prevent accurate word recognition
  2. Limited background knowledge or vocabulary that constrains meaning construction (correct answer)
  3. Inadequate decoding fluency that consumes cognitive resources needed for comprehension
  4. Poor spelling abilities that interfere with orthographic pattern recognition during reading
Explanation: Since these students demonstrate strong decoding, phonological awareness, and spelling skills, their comprehension difficulties are most likely due to limited background knowledge or vocabulary. The Simple View of Reading indicates that comprehension = decoding × language comprehension. When decoding is strong but comprehension is weak, the bottleneck typically lies in language comprehension components like vocabulary and background knowledge.

Question 4

A fifth-grade student demonstrates excellent decoding accuracy and strong vocabulary knowledge when assessed individually, but struggles with reading comprehension during classroom instruction. The student also shows difficulty with writing tasks that require organizing multiple ideas. Which literacy component relationship best explains this pattern?

  1. Weak phonological awareness is limiting both spelling accuracy and reading fluency development
  2. Insufficient background knowledge prevents activation of relevant schema during text processing
  3. Limited verbal reasoning skills affect both text comprehension and written expression organization (correct answer)
  4. Poor automatic word recognition creates cognitive overload that impairs higher-level thinking processes
Explanation: The student's strong decoding and vocabulary but weak comprehension and writing organization suggests difficulty with verbal reasoning skills. Verbal reasoning involves making inferences, understanding relationships between ideas, and organizing information logically - skills needed for both reading comprehension and coherent writing. This explains the parallel difficulties in both areas despite adequate foundational skills.

Question 5

A literacy coach analyzes assessment data showing that students who demonstrate strong performance on both nonsense word reading and vocabulary measures consistently outperform students who are strong in only one of these areas on reading comprehension tasks. This finding most directly supports which understanding about literacy components?

  1. Nonsense word reading ability predicts vocabulary development more accurately than real word recognition
  2. Reading comprehension depends primarily on decoding speed rather than accuracy or language knowledge
  3. Vocabulary instruction should be delayed until students achieve fluent nonsense word reading skills
  4. Both accurate decoding and language comprehension components are necessary for successful reading comprehension (correct answer)
Explanation: This question tests your understanding of the Simple View of Reading, a foundational literacy framework that explains reading comprehension as the product of two essential components: decoding skills and language comprehension. The assessment data reveals a crucial pattern: students excel at reading comprehension only when they're strong in both nonsense word reading (which measures pure decoding ability, since these aren't real words students could memorize) and vocabulary knowledge (a key indicator of language comprehension). Students strong in just one area don't perform as well, demonstrating that both components work together. Answer D correctly identifies this relationship—successful reading comprehension requires both accurate decoding and language comprehension components working in tandem. This directly reflects the Simple View of Reading model. Answer A incorrectly suggests nonsense word reading predicts vocabulary development, but the data shows these are separate skills that both contribute to comprehension rather than one predicting the other. Answer B misinterprets the findings by claiming comprehension depends primarily on decoding speed, when the data actually shows vocabulary knowledge is equally important. Answer C makes a harmful instructional recommendation to delay vocabulary instruction, which contradicts the evidence that both components need simultaneous development. Question 6

Research indicates that students with strong oral language skills but poor phonological awareness often show a specific pattern: they can understand complex texts when read aloud to them but struggle to decode simple texts independently. Which literacy component relationship does this pattern most clearly illustrate?

  1. Background knowledge compensates for weaknesses in all other literacy components during text processing
  2. Listening comprehension and reading comprehension develop through entirely different cognitive pathways
  3. Phonological awareness serves as a necessary foundation for developing accurate decoding skills (correct answer)
  4. Vocabulary knowledge automatically transfers to word recognition abilities without additional instruction
Explanation: This pattern demonstrates that phonological awareness is necessary for decoding development but not for listening comprehension. Students can understand complex language when decoding demands are removed (listening), but cannot access texts independently without phonological awareness to support decoding. This illustrates the specific, foundational role of phonological awareness in the decoding component of reading.

Question 7

A reading intervention program reports that students who received combined phonological awareness and vocabulary instruction showed greater comprehension gains than students who received either component alone, despite equivalent improvements in decoding accuracy across all groups. This outcome best supports which principle about literacy development?

  1. Comprehension skills develop independently of decoding abilities and require separate instructional approaches
  2. Decoding accuracy serves as the sole predictor of reading comprehension success in intervention programs
  3. Phonological awareness instruction is unnecessary once students develop adequate vocabulary knowledge
  4. Multiple literacy components interact synergistically to support reading comprehension beyond their individual contributions (correct answer)
Explanation: This question tests your understanding of how different literacy skills work together in reading development. When you encounter research scenarios about reading interventions, focus on how the outcomes reveal relationships between foundational skills like phonics, vocabulary, and comprehension. The key insight here is that students with combined instruction outperformed those with single-component instruction, even though all groups showed equal decoding improvements. This demonstrates that literacy components don't just add together—they multiply each other's effects. When phonological awareness and vocabulary instruction are combined, they create synergistic effects that boost comprehension beyond what either skill contributes alone. Answer D correctly identifies this synergistic interaction. The research shows that multiple literacy components working together produce greater gains than the sum of their individual parts. Answer A is wrong because it suggests comprehension develops independently of other skills, contradicting the evidence that combined instruction was superior. Answer B incorrectly claims decoding accuracy is the sole predictor of comprehension, but the study shows students with equal decoding had different comprehension outcomes based on their instruction type. Answer C falsely suggests phonological awareness becomes unnecessary with vocabulary development, but the research demonstrates that combining both components produces the best results. Question 8

A teacher observes that students who struggle with rapid automatic naming tasks in first grade often continue to have reading fluency difficulties in third grade, despite receiving effective phonics instruction. This pattern most clearly demonstrates which aspect of literacy component relationships?

  1. Phonological awareness deficits prevent students from benefiting from systematic decoding instruction
  2. Underlying processing speed differences affect the development of automatic word recognition over time (correct answer)
  3. Vocabulary limitations create persistent barriers to reading comprehension across grade levels
  4. Spelling irregularities in English prevent fluent reading regardless of instructional quality
Explanation: Rapid automatic naming (RAN) tasks assess processing speed and the ability to quickly retrieve verbal labels for visual stimuli. Students with slow RAN often develop adequate decoding skills but struggle to achieve automatic word recognition. This demonstrates how underlying processing speed affects the development of fluency, even when phonics knowledge is solid.

Question 9

A reading specialist notices that students with strong listening comprehension but weak text reading comprehension often improve significantly when provided with fluency interventions, even without direct comprehension instruction. This observation best illustrates which relationship among literacy components?

  1. Background knowledge directly influences phonological awareness development in beginning readers
  2. Automatic word recognition frees cognitive resources that can then be allocated to comprehension processes (correct answer)
  3. Vocabulary knowledge is entirely dependent on decoding accuracy for successful text comprehension
  4. Spelling proficiency serves as the primary foundation for all other reading skills development
Explanation: This scenario demonstrates how automatic word recognition (fluency) frees up cognitive resources for comprehension. Students with good listening comprehension have the language skills needed for understanding, but when word recognition is effortful, it consumes working memory capacity that should be devoted to meaning-making. Fluency interventions make word recognition automatic, allowing cognitive resources to focus on comprehension.

Question 10

Research shows that students who receive intensive phonological awareness training in kindergarten often demonstrate improved spelling performance two years later, even without direct spelling instruction during the intervention period. This delayed effect most directly reflects which principle about literacy component relationships?

  1. Phonological awareness provides the conceptual foundation for understanding spelling patterns and orthographic conventions (correct answer)
  2. Early phonological skills automatically transfer to writing abilities regardless of instructional emphasis
  3. Spelling development is entirely independent of other literacy components and develops through maturation
  4. Phonological awareness training directly improves visual memory for whole word recognition patterns
Explanation: Phonological awareness provides the foundational understanding that words are composed of sounds that can be manipulated, which is essential for understanding how spelling represents these sound structures. This conceptual foundation supports later spelling development as students learn orthographic patterns. The delayed effect demonstrates how foundational skills support more complex literacy abilities that develop later.
